Aït Melloul Prison

[1] A second facility was opened in 2016 in order to replace the historical prison in Inezgane.

[2][3] In 2018, 5 people were injured, and considerable damage was done after a fire broke out in a hallway, according to local firefighters, the fire was quickly put out.

[7][8] In 2003, a student from Agadir, Abdelkarim Azzou, was arrested and taken to Aït Melloul Prison.

Azzou claimed to be subject to "the cruelest form of torture that can exist" and was forced to sign a false confession, Azzou was detained without a trial for 2 years.

Abdelkarim Azzou was sentenced to 20 years in prison for terrorism charges, the sentence was reduced to 12 years on appeal.
